Recipe for Mustard-Braised Chicken Jb

Yield:
4 Servings
Ingredients:
Amount Ingredient
3 tbl Olive oil
2 tbl Minced fresh thyme
3 tsp Minced fresh marjoram
1/2 tsp Dry mustard
1 tsp Minced fresh rosemary
1 x Chicken, (3 1/2-lb) cut into 8 pieces
1/2 cup Finely chopped onion
2 tbl Minced garlic
1 cup Dry white wine
1 cup Canned low-salt chicken broth
Instructions:
Instructions: Stir 1 tablespoon oil, 1 tablespoon thyme, 1 1/2 teaspoons marjoram, dry mustard and 1/2 teaspoon rosemary in small bowl until paste forms. Rub paste all over chicken. Place in bowl; chill 2 hours or overnight.

Heat 2 tablespoons oil in heavy large pot over medium-high heat. Sprinkle chicken with salt and pepper. Add chicken to pot and cook until brown on all sides, about 12 minutes. Transfer to bowl.

Add onion to pot; saute over medium-high heat until tender, about 8 minutes. Add garlic; saute 2 minutes. Add wine, broth, Dijon mustard and 1 tablespoon thyme, 1 1/2 teaspoons marjoram and 1/2 teaspoon rosemary to pot. Bring to boil. Return chicken to pot. Reduce heat to medium-low.

Cover; simmer until chicken is cooked, about 25 minutes.

Transfer chicken to platter; cover to keep warm. Boil liquid in pot until thickened to sauce consistency, whisking often, about 10 minutes. Season sauce with salt and pepper. Pour over chicken.
